Chinese women dominate the ranks of self-made billionaires, according to a report by Hurun research institute.

Fifty percent of the top 10 of the wealthiest self-made women in the world are Chinese, according to the report. China's touchscreen queen and founder of Lens Technology, Zhou Qunfei, heads the list. With a fortune of $9.8 billion, Zhou also topped the list in 2015.

China is home to the most billionaires with a total of 819, outpacing the U.S. which is home to 571.

Building Wealth

Property development remains the biggest source of wealth for self-made women in China. Chongqing-based Wu Yajun was the second-richest self-made woman in China. Real-estate tycoon Wu is worth $9.3 billion after her wealth surged 83 percent over the past 12 months. Chen Lihua, who topped the self-made female rich list in 2017, dropped to third place as her wealth increased less rapidly to $8.1 billion from $7.2 billion from last year.
